A French door fridge freezer is a kind of refrigerator that features 2 full-sized doors on the leading section for the refrigerator, together with a different pull-out drawer or compartment at the bottom for the freezer. This design not only optimizes storage capacity however also permits simple access to regularly utilized products. The large shelving and versatile company alternatives make it a maximum option for modern-day cooking areas.

Before buying, it is essential for customers to think about the following elements:
Space Availability: Measure the assigned location in the kitchen to ensure that the fridge freezer will fit, including door swing space.
Energy Efficiency: Evaluate energy rankings to prepare for running expenses and find a design that aligns with sustainability goals.
Features vs. Price: Determine which functions are essential and compare those versus the budget plan to find the very best value product.
Maintenance and Cleaning: Consider models with easy-to-clean surface areas and removable racks for practical upkeep.
Warranty and Aftercare: Look for brand names that use detailed service warranties and robust aftercare options.
Q1: How do I measure a French door fridge freezer space?
To measure for your brand-new fridge, utilize a tape measure to check both the height and width of the designated space in your cooking area. Likewise, account for door clearance when opened and permit extra space for ventilation.
Q2: Do French door fridge freezers have a greater energy intake?
Typically, French door fridges are energy-efficient, especially more recent models rated A+ or above. Nevertheless, their energy consumption can be greater than conventional top-freezer models due to bigger sizes and extra functions.
Q3: Can I fit a French door fridge freezer in a small kitchen?
While French door fridges generally require more area than basic designs, compact versions are readily available. Guarantee an extensive measurement of your kitchen area layout before considering size.

Q5: Are water and ice dispensers worth it?
This depends upon individual choices. While they use convenience, users should think about potential maintenance and the need for regular water filter replacements.
